Water 'Bankruptcy' Era Has Begun for Billions, Scientists Say

Summary

The Bloomberg article reports scientists warning of a looming 'water bankruptcy' for billions due to drought, over-extraction, and climate change. It calls for integrated water management, greater infrastructure investment, and data-driven policy to avert a resource crisis, highlighting how technology can forecast demand and optimize allocation.
